How to care for Phalaenopsis orchids after shooting arrows

About 45 days after Phalaenopsis orchids shoot arrows, they will bloom, so after shooting arrows, it is necessary to pay attention to the care of temperature, water, light, and fertilizer. Maintain a stable growth temperature between 16-30℃, keep the potting soil moist when watering, choose bright, warm, and sufficient light to nourish, and promptly apply fertilizer after shooting arrows, using diluted compound fertilizers containing n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ium.

After Phalaenopsis orchids shoot arrows, they can bloom in about 45 days, but controlling the temperature is very important. There can be a daily temperature difference but not too large, with the best growth temperature stabilizing between 16-30℃. When shooting arrows in summer, it's best to prepare for ventilation and cooling to avoid growth problems caused by high temperatures.

Phalaenopsis orchids require more water after shooting arrows than usual, so watering must be thorough, preferably in the early morning or evening. Do not water directly on the flower spike, and like regular watering, ensure that the potting soil is moist and meets the growth needs of the Phalaenopsis orchid.

Since the Phalaenopsis orchid has already shot arrows normally, it means that the blooming period is not far off. To ensure that the Phalaenopsis orchid can bloom normally and the flower spike does not rot in the plant, it is necessary to nourish with bright, warm, and sufficient light to bring the blooming period forward.

Shooting arrows and blooming require a lot of nutritional components, so after Phalaenopsis orchids shoot arrows, it is necessary to apply fertilizer promptly to supplement the nutrients needed for growth. Using diluted n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ium compound fertilizers or potassium dihydrogen phosphate solution can yield good results.
